
Brauneberger Juffer Sonnenuhr, Riesling, Grosses Gewächs, 2024
The Juffer Sonnenuhr GG routinely offers a little more roundness next to the Juffer, thanks to its slightly warmer exposure in the heart of the vineyard, old vines and a longer fermentation. Clear cut and classic in feel, not showy but silky and poised, as ever. Ageing is carried out in wood.

The 2024 Juffer GG Brauneberg Riesling displays a dense yet subtle and elegant slate nose with ripe, pleasantly concentrated fruit aromas that do not overwhelm the slate notes. Juicy, spicy, and full-bodied, this is a generous, lively and mouth-filling Riesling with the typical Brauneberg delicacy and finesse. The finish is stimulatingly salty, balanced and light-footed yet also substantial. There are grapefruit bitters in the aftertaste. Tasted at the Vorpremiere VDP.Grosses Gewachs in Wiesbaden, August 2025.
The 2024 Riesling Brauneberger Juffer Sonnenuhr Grosses Gewächs is from old vines between 30 and 80 years old, with some vines planted in the first decade of the last century. Density, serenity and subtlety stand out immediately. The nose is shy, but the palate has substance, stoniness and juiciness. Everything here is compact, with gorgeously racy acidity, fill and suppleness on a superbly contoured, stony body. The 2024 is wonderful, understated and serene. (Bone-dry)
